Wild Card Round Start ‘Em: Quarterbacks
Kirk Cousins vs. Giants (Sun. 4:30 p.m. ET, Fox): Cousins has been a solid fantasy option at home, scoring 18-plus points in seven of nine games including five with more than 21 points. One of those games came against New York, as Cousins posted three touchdowns and 21.2 fantasy points against them back in Week 16. The Giants also have allowed 24-plus points to two QBs since Week 14.
Daniel Jones at Vikings (Sun. 4:30 p.m. ET, Fox): Jones was one of the best quarterbacks in fantasy football in the postseason, posting two games with more than 20 points. One of those contests came against the Vikings, who surrendered 334 passing yards and 20.8 points to the versatile quarterback. Minnesota gave up the seventh-most points to quarterbacks this season, so Jones is a nice option.

Dak Prescott at Buccaneers (Mon. 8:15 p.m. ET, ESPN): Prescott has been very tough to trust in recent weeks, throwing at least one interception in seven consecutive games. He’s also failed to score more than 17 points in all but two of those games. This week’s matchup against the Buccaneers isn’t terrible on paper, but Dak’s recent proneness to turnovers makes him a real risk this weekend.

Geno Smith at 49ers (Sat. 4:30 p.m. ET, Fox): Smith had a surprisingly solid year in fantasy land, scoring 31 total touchdowns and better than 300 points. Still, I have a hard time trusting him in what is a tough matchup in San Francisco. In two games against the NFC West rival during the regular season, Smith scored a combined 21.4 points. That includes a 6.1-point stinker against them on the road.
